More than 50 mummified mice, mummified falcons and other bird species were discovered in a beautifully decorated 2,000-year-old tomb in the Egyptian town of Sohag earlier last week. / VCG Photo

The mice and other animals were found surrounding two mummified human bodies. / VCG Photo

After years of instability and insecurity, the Egyptian government hope the new discoveries will help attract visitors back to the country. / VCG Photo
